
(ThePatriotWire)- Former vice president Mike Pence will urge the pro-life community on Wednesday night to “stay the course” in its fight against abortion, saying the eventual objective must be to make abortion “unthinkable.”
In his first public address since Roe v. Wade’s overturn, Pence will call the decision a “turning point in American history” but stress that the fight has just begun as “new battlefields are emerging in every state in the land,” according to a draft of his remarks obtained by the Washington Free Beacon.
Pence will say that our task remains the same in our fast-changing post-Roe America. It’s to stop the culture of death, restore a culture of life, and bring the sanctity of human life to the core of American law.
The reversal of Roe transformed the political scene for the 2022 midterms and 2024 Republican presidential primary. Pence will give his Wednesday night speech at the Florence Baptist Temple in South Carolina, a critical early primary state.
Pence will proclaim the Trump administration “the most pro-life ever.” Pence’s participation in advising the president to choose Justices Neil Gorsuch, Brett Kavanaugh, and Amy Coney Barrett is one of the most meaningful moments of his life.
Ending constitutional protection for abortion and returning regulation to the states initiated a new struggle to make abortion unthinkable by making it easier for moms to choose life, according to Pence.
Pence said that we should aim to make abortion unfathomable for every American, not simply illegal. America should make doing the right thing easy. We must make life easy for every American.
Pence urges Americans to elect pro-life leaders who can usher in a new pro-life beginning in America and promote laws that make choosing life easier for women, such as adoption reform and pregnancy help centers. He also wants new child support rules to guarantee fathers support their unborn kids.
“Life begins at conception—and so do a father’s obligations,” Pence will remark.
